Under the new agreement signed with the SPA des Cantons, the Town of Sutton has entrusted the organization with the following services:

Issuance of dog licenses

In accordance with section 3 of By-law RM 410 – By-law concerning animal control (in French only), the owners of any dog living on the territory of Sutton must obtain a permit for the possession of the animal, and they may not possess more than two dogs at the same address:

  • The cost of the permit is $20 per year (+ $5 for the first year for the cost of the tag); the permit must be renewed each year.
  • A tag is given at the first registration and must be worn by the animal.
  • The request for a permit must be addressed directly to the SPA des Cantons and can be done online and by selecting the Town of Sutton.

Pet Complaint Management

The S.P.A des Cantons is now responsible for handling and following up on complaints concerning domestic animals, whether they be dangerous dogs or nuisances caused by a domestic animal.

Please note that the SPA does not handle cases involving wild animals (e.g.: foxes that are sick or suspected of having rabies), which must be addressed to the Ministère des Forêts, de la Faune et des Parcs at 1-877-346-6763.

Stray cat or dog pick-up

The Townships Animal Control Society is responsible for picking up stray cats and dogs reported on our territory. In the case of cats, it participates in the CSR program which consists of capturing, sterilizing, treating, vaccinating and releasing cats so that they return to their environment in good health and without risk of reproduction.

Dog owners: Please use the bags!

30 March 2023

As soon as the snow melts, we have the unpleasant surprise of discovering numerous dog droppings, especially on the bike path, but also elsewhere on the public roads. We reiterate our request to dog owners to pick up after their dogs, for the public good and the respect of other users.

We would like to remind you that Article 35 of By-law number 226 concerning animals stipulates that it is MANDATORY to pick up your pet’s feces in parks, on public roads and on private property.

To this end, the Town provides free biodegradable bag dispensers in several public areas to pick up feces, as well as nearby garbage cans: please use them!

New off-leash dog ban measures at PENS

26 July 2023

The Parc d’environnement de Sutton (PENS) has strengthened its resources to enforce the ban on off-leash dog walking on its trails. New signs have been installed and park wardens, authorized by the Town, have been hired to enforce municipal regulations.

Walking your dog without a leash on the trails of the Parc d’environnement naturel de Sutton could result in a $200 fine.

Similarly, wild camping or campfires are also liable to a fine, as these prohibitions are designed to protect the environment and hikers.

Dogs must be kept on a leash!

15 November 2023

Pending the construction of the future dog park (winning project of the participative budget) next year, we would like to remind dog owners that it is compulsory to keep your pet on a leash in public spaces, and particularly to ensure that you keep it under control in the presence of other people or other dogs.

Unfortunately, incidents involving dogs running at large and attacking other dogs on a leash continue to be reported. Any owner of a dog causing damage is liable to fines and/or prosecution.
